Question:

The local community theater sold a total of 240 tickets for Saturday night’s performance. They sold 180 more full-price tickets than discount tickets. Which system of equations can be used to model this situation?

Answer:

x = 180 + y

x + y = 240

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

Tickets = 240

Represent the number of full price with x and discounted price with y.

From the question:

x = 180 more than y

So:

x = 180 + y

Also, a total of 240 were sold.

So:

x + y = 240

Hence, the equations are:

x = 180 + y

x + y = 240

Solving further;

Substitute 180 + y for x in x + y = 240

180 + y + y = 240

180 + 2y = 240

Solve for 2y

2y = 240 - 180

2y = 60

Divide through by 2

y = 30

Recall that: x = 180 + y

x = 180 + 30

x = 210

Hence:

<em>Full Price = 210</em>

<em>Discounted = 30</em>

Answer:

651 is the minimum number of people over age 30 they must include in their sample.        

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given the following information:

Confidence level = 90%

Significance level = 10%

Maximum error = 0.09

Variance = 1.96

\text{Standard Deviation} = \sqrt{\text{Variance}} = \sqrt{1.96} = 1.4

Formula:

\text{Error} = z_{critical}\dfrac{\sigma}{\sqrt{n}}

Putting all the values,

z_{critical}\text{ at}~\alpha_{0.05} = \pm 1.64

0.09 = 1.64\times \dfrac{1.4}{\sqrt{n}}\\\\n = (\dfrac{1.64\times 1.4}{0.09})^2 = 650.81 \approx 651

651 is the minimum number of people over age 30 they must include in their sample.
